| HB 0021 | Pub. Rec./Agency Employees by Kendall | ||||
| Pub. Rec./Agency Employees: Provides exemption from public records requirements for certain identifying & location information of current or former agency employees & spouses & children of such employees; provides for retroactive application; specifies that exemption does not limit certain existing exemptions; provides for future legislative review & repeal of exemption; provides statement of public necessity. Effective Date: upon becoming a law | |||||

| SB 0350 | Public Records/Crime Victims by Grall | ||||
| Public Records/Crime Victims; Expanding a public records exemption for crime victims to include the name and personal identification number of a victim and any other information that could be used to locate, intimidate, harass, or abuse the victim; providing that such exemption includes the portions of records generated by any agency that regularly generates or receives information from or concerning victims of crime; providing for a public records exemption for the identity of a victim’s family member, lawful representative, or next of kin and any other information that could be used to locate, intimidate, harass, or abuse these individuals; providing for future legislative review and repeal of the exemptions; providing a statement of public necessity, etc. Effective Date: 7/1/2026 | |||||
